Virgin Voyages introduces new booking platform

To celebrate the launch of LetsGoBook the line is offering $100,000 in bonuses, plus the chance to win a trip to Necker Island


By Cruise Adviser


On Sep 9, 2022

Virgin Voyages has introduced a brand new booking platform called LetsGoBook, which allows agents to book clients onto the line faster and more easily.

The streamlined interface is part of VirginVoyages.com and was developed following feedback by First Mates (as Virgin refers to travel agents) and offers a simpler, intuitive system that has been designed to take the friction out of the booking process.

Every new booking made using LetsGoBook will be automatically connected to agents’ accounts on FirstMates.com and includes 16 per cent commission.

To celebrate the launch Virgin is rewarding agents with a $100,000 booking bonus, with a $50 (£42) cash bonus for the first 2,000 new bookings made using the LetsGoBook link.

Additionally, every booking will be entered into a draw to win a seven-night trip to Necker Island, Richard Branon’s private, luxury estate in the British Virgin Islands.

“Our First Mates asked for a more streamlined and straightforward booking platform, and we’ve delivered,” said John Dioro, vice president of North American Sales.

“This new, easy-to-use interface saves First Mates time on the historically tedious booking process so they can dedicate more time helping their Sailors curate an unforgettable vacation aboard our ships.”
